Have you actually used the Swiss rail site to see what the day from Venice - Brig - glacier - Brig - Luzern would be like? Here is what it would look like:
Depart Venice 07.50, arrive Brig 13.16
Depart Brig 13.48, arrive Bettmeralp 14.30
14.30 - 16.30 hike (only hike out 1h and return 1h)
16.55 Depart Bettmeralp, arrive Luzern 20.00
Note that it will be dusk around 16.30.
So, that is about 9 or 10 hours of travelling just to enjoy 2h of hiking or looking at the scenery. That truly seems lop-sided to me, especially considering there is a glacier on Titlis you could see instead.
http://www.titlis.ch/en/glacier
The normal travel time between Venice & Luzern is 7h30 to 8h. You could leave Venice at 08.50 and be in Luzern at 16.20. If it were me, I would get the transport over with and spend time in the destination. Feeding the swans at the lake at dusk can be magical. Enjoy a nice dinner, then be ready for the Titlis glacier the next day.
